数控铣床编程f是什么
-
数控铣床编程是指使用计算机编程语言,通过数控系统控制铣床进行加工操作的过程。其中,F是数控铣床编程中的一个重要参数,用来控制铣刀的进给速度。下面将详细介绍F在数控铣床编程中的作用和使用方法。
F是数控铣床编程中的进给速度指令,它决定了铣刀在工件上的运动速度。在编写数控铣床程序时,需要使用F指令来控制铣刀的进给速度。F指令的数值代表了铣刀每分钟移动的距离,单位通常为毫米/分钟或英寸/分钟。
F指令的格式通常为"F数值",例如"F100"表示进给速度为100毫米/分钟。在数控铣床编程中,可以通过设置不同的F值来实现不同的进给速度,从而满足不同工件的加工要求。
在实际应用中,选择合适的F值对于保证加工质量和提高生产效率非常重要。如果F值过小,铣刀的进给速度会变慢,加工时间会延长;如果F值过大,铣刀的进给速度会变快,可能导致切削过深、刀具磨损加剧甚至损坏。
在确定F值时,需要综合考虑工件材料、刀具类型、切削条件等因素。通常,较硬的材料需要较小的F值,而较软的材料可以选择较大的F值。此外,不同刀具的建议进给速度也有所不同,需要根据刀具厂家的推荐进行设置。
在编写数控铣床程序时,除了设置F值外,还需要注意合理设置切削深度、进给速度等参数,以确保加工过程中的稳定性和效率。同时,也需要根据实际情况进行试切和调整,不断优化加工参数,以获得最佳的加工效果。
总之,F是数控铣床编程中控制进给速度的重要参数,合理设置F值可以提高加工效率和质量。在编写数控铣床程序时,需要根据工件材料、刀具类型等因素选择合适的F值,并在实际应用中进行调整和优化。
1年前 -
数控铣床编程(简称CNC铣床编程)是指使用计算机控制系统对数控铣床进行编程操作的过程。通过编写特定的指令代码,控制数控铣床按照预定的路径和加工参数进行自动化加工。下面是关于数控铣床编程的五个要点:
-
编程语言:数控铣床编程使用特定的编程语言,常见的有G代码和M代码。G代码是用于定义加工路径和运动方式的指令,而M代码是用于定义机床的辅助功能和操作指令。程序员需要根据加工要求,编写相应的G代码和M代码,以实现所需的加工操作。
-
加工路径规划:在数控铣床编程中,需要通过编写G代码来定义加工路径。程序员需要根据零件的几何形状和加工要求,确定合适的刀具路径,以确保加工精度和效率。常见的加工路径包括直线插补、圆弧插补、螺旋线插补等。
-
刀具选择和切削参数:在数控铣床编程中,需要根据零件的材料和加工要求,选择合适的刀具,并设置切削参数。刀具的选择包括刀具类型、刀具尺寸和刀具材质等,而切削参数包括切削速度、进给速度和切削深度等。合理的刀具选择和切削参数可以提高加工效率和加工质量。
-
安全考虑:在数控铣床编程中,需要考虑安全因素,以保证操作人员和设备的安全。程序员需要合理设置刀具路径,避免刀具与夹具、工件或机床发生碰撞。此外,还需要注意刀具的切削深度和切削速度,避免过度负荷导致刀具折断或机床损坏。
-
调试和优化:在数控铣床编程完成后,需要进行调试和优化。程序员需要通过模拟或实际加工来验证程序的正确性和稳定性,并根据实际情况进行调整和优化。调试和优化的目的是确保程序能够顺利运行并获得满意的加工效果。
总之,数控铣床编程是一项关键的技术,它涉及到编程语言、加工路径规划、刀具选择和切削参数、安全考虑以及调试和优化等方面。掌握数控铣床编程技术可以提高加工效率、加工质量和安全性,对于现代制造业具有重要意义。
1年前 -
-
数控铣床编程(G-code programming)是一种通过输入G代码来控制数控铣床进行加工操作的方法。G代码是一种专门用于控制数控机床的指令代码,它包含了各种运动控制、速度控制、刀具补偿、坐标系设置等功能。
数控铣床编程的操作流程主要包括以下几个步骤:
-
设计工件和工艺:在进行数控铣床编程之前,首先需要对要加工的工件进行设计,并确定加工的工艺和刀具选择。
-
建立坐标系:在编程之前,需要确定数控铣床的坐标系。坐标系通常包括原点位置、工件坐标系和机床坐标系。
-
确定刀具路径:根据工件的形状和加工要求,确定刀具的路径。刀具路径通常包括插补路径、切削路径和退刀路径。
-
编写G代码:根据刀具路径和加工要求,编写相应的G代码。G代码中包含了各种指令,如运动指令(G00、G01)、速度指令(G04)、切削指令(G41、G42)等。
-
调试和优化:编写完G代码后,需要进行调试和优化,以确保编程的准确性和效率。可以通过模拟软件或者在实际机床上进行试切来进行调试。
-
上传和运行:调试完成后,将G代码上传到数控铣床的控制系统中。在运行前,需要进行相关的设置,如坐标系原点的设定、刀具长度补偿的设定等。
-
监控和调整:在数控铣床加工过程中,需要不断监控加工质量和机床状态,并及时进行调整和修正。
总结起来,数控铣床编程是一种通过输入G代码来控制数控铣床进行加工操作的方法。通过设计工件和工艺,建立坐标系,确定刀具路径,编写G代码,调试和优化,上传和运行,监控和调整等步骤,可以实现高效、精确的数控铣削加工。
1年前 -